App Inventor 2 – Nuova release da nb193 a nb194c (14 settembre 2023)

Modifiche tra nb194c e nb195 (26 novembre 2023)

Questa è una versione del componente che include correzioni di bug e miglioramenti. Include un nuovo Android MIT AI2 Companion, versioni 2.69 (da Google Play) o 2.69u (scaricato direttamente da MIT App Inventor).

Correzioni di bug:

Corretta la gestione degli errori in ChatBot e ImageBot Passare correttamente il codice di stato HTTP dal proxy Chat/Image Bot
Correzione di un elenco per individuare bug con le chiavi FString
Corrette le connessioni USB che non caricano le estensioni
Ripristinata la sostituzione degli spazi nel nome del progetto (#2991)
Filtra metodi, eventi e proprietà deprecati quando si utilizza la tastiera per inserire i nomi dei blocchi
Impedisci al Player di riprodurre in Companion quando cambi schermata
Assicurato che lo stato del Player venga reimpostato al termine
Rispondi ai messaggi solo se destinati al WebViewer
Risolti i problemi relativi ai pulsanti che non assumevano un colore di sfondo traslucido
Risolti gli arresti anomali del Companion segnalati da Google

Miglioramenti:

Consenti il ​​caricamento di contenuti multimediali dalla directory privata facendo riferimento a /data/
Il logo ora è un file SVG, che si adatta meglio
Fornisci un messaggio di errore relativo alle estensioni per la Galleria Le estensioni non sono consentite nella Galleria, questa modifica fornisce un messaggio di errore migliore.
Implementare la proprietà ResponseTextEncoding per il componente Web
Aggiungi il blocco ‘RemoveItemAtIndex’ a ListView
Implementare una finestra di dialogo Proprietà progetto
Consenti il ​​filtraggio dei componenti nella struttura di origine Introduciamo un menu a discesa che consente di selezionare se devono vedere tutti i componenti o solo quelli visibili o quelli non visibili.
Aggiungi il pulsante Invia alla galleria al modello della barra degli strumenti del designer

Per gli sviluppatori:

Mantieni le classi di estensione nel pacchetto di estensioni durante la protezione
Scarica phantomJS durante l’azione build on github
Rendi il comando java_dev_appserver.sh a riga singola in README.md

Altri cambiamenti interni:

Passa all’API di esportazione gviz per il foglio di calcolo
Correggi i report sulle statistiche del buildserver disallineati
Carica e confronta le proprietà del progetto nei test
Invia solo l’intestazione Strict Transport Security utilizzando https
Rimuovi il codice obsoleto nella gestione Bluetooth per le versioni precedenti di Android
Rimuovere la logica inutilizzata e il controllo dei flag di funzionalità

Dalla pagina originale https://appinventor.mit.edu/ai2/ReleaseNotes